ORDERS.

On motion of Mr. Williams, of, Harford, it was
Ordered, That the following be added to Rule XVI, of
the. Rules of the Senate, that is to say:

On each of said committees the majority and minority
of the Senate shall be entitled to representation propor-
tionate to their respective membership.

Which was read, and referred to the Committee on
Rules.

On motion of Mr. Crothers, it was

Ordered, That the President of the Senate be and he
is hereby authorized to appoint a clerk to the Committee
on Finance; also, such other officers in and about the
Senate as may be needed, not to exceed five in number.

On motion of Mr. Beasman, it was

Ordered, That Senators Brewington, Ravenscroft and
Gray be excused from to-day's session on account of im-
portant business.
